自動彈出 CSS 彈窗在頁面中非常實用,可以幫助網(wǎng)站更好地與用戶進(jìn)行交互。這種彈窗可以在用戶執(zhí)行某些操作時自動彈出,提醒用戶進(jìn)行操作或提供重要信息。
要實現(xiàn)自動彈出 CSS 彈窗,我們可以使用 JavaScript 和 CSS。下面是一個基本的實現(xiàn)代碼:
// CSS 樣式 .popup { position: fixed; top: 50%; left: 50%; transform: translate(-50%, -50%); padding: 20px; background-color: #fff; box-shadow: 0px 0px 10px rgba(0,0,0,.2); z-index: 9999; } // JavaScript 代碼 window.onload = function() { // 在這里寫彈窗自動彈出的條件,比如用戶在頁面停留時間達(dá)到 10 秒,或者用戶執(zhí)行了某些操作 // 如果條件成立,則執(zhí)行下面的代碼 var popup = document.createElement("div"); popup.className = "popup"; popup.innerHTML = "這里是彈窗的內(nèi)容"; document.body.appendChild(popup); }
在上面的代碼中,我們定義了一個 CSS 樣式,用于設(shè)置彈窗的樣式。接著,我們使用 JavaScript 創(chuàng)建了一個 div 元素,添加了樣式和內(nèi)容,并將其添加到 body 標(biāo)簽中。最后,在 onload 事件中設(shè)置彈窗自動彈出的條件。
這只是一個基本的實現(xiàn),你可以根據(jù)自己的需求來修改,添加更多的樣式或功能。比如,你可以添加關(guān)閉按鈕或動畫效果,或者使用更復(fù)雜的條件來控制彈窗的顯示。